Samsung PL120 vs Sony QX10 Sensor Comparison

Often, its hard to see the contrast in sensor sizes just by viewing specifications. The pic below will help provide you a more clear sense of the sensor sizing in the PL120 and QX10.

To sum up, each of these cameras posses the exact same sensor measurements but not the same MP. You should anticipate the Sony QX10 to render greater detail due to its extra 4MP. Greater resolution will also let you crop pics somewhat more aggressively. The more aged PL120 will be disadvantaged with regard to sensor innovation.
